A Role of a Load Technician: Abilities & Obligations

A load tester undertakes a key function within an organization, essentially centered on ensuring application reliability under intense customer traffic . The fundamental responsibilities include creating simulated assessment situations , writing scripted test sets, and interpreting the output. Required talents encompass competence in load testing platforms like LoadRunner , the good understanding of infrastructure , and the to clearly report findings to technical departments. Additionally , these individuals often work with developers to identify and fix stability concerns before live launch.

Understanding Load Test Metrics & Analysis

To properly assess load test results, one must precisely observe key indicators and undertake comprehensive analysis . Vital metrics encompass response time , which indicates how long the application takes to reply to requests ; capacity , indicating the quantity of operations handled per second ; failure rate , showing the ratio of rejected requests ; and system resources , like processor use and memory consumption . Analyzing these statistics allows you to pinpoint limitations and improve the general stability and flexibility of your platform.
